Thursday, October 19: Old Dubai

Immerse yourself in the rich history and culture of Dubai by exploring the historic neighborhood of Al Fahidi. Start your morning with a visit to the Dubai Museum, housed in the 18th-century Al Fahidi Fort. Learn about the city's transformation and traditional way of life. Afterward, stroll through the narrow lanes of Al Bastakiya, admiring the traditional wind-tower houses and art galleries. In the afternoon, take an abra (traditional boat) ride across Dubai Creek to the bustling Deira district. Explore the vibrant markets, known as souks, and indulge in some shopping. End your day by enjoying a delicious Arabic dinner at a local restaurant.

  • Dubai Museum: Cost Estimate - AED 3 (entrance fee),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Al Fahidi (Al Bastakiya):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Deira Souks: Cost Estimate - Dependent on shopping,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
Friday, October 20: Burj Khalifa and Dubai Mall

Rise early and head to the iconic Burj Khalifa, the tallest building in the world. Take in breathtaking panoramic views of the city from the observation deck on the 148th floor. Afterward, visit the Dubai Mall, located at the base of Burj Khalifa. Explore its vast array of shops, indulge in some retail therapy, and visit the Dubai Aquarium and Underwater Zoo. In the afternoon, relax and enjoy a decadent afternoon tea at one of the mall's luxurious cafes. In the evening, witness the magical Dubai Fountain show, which takes place every 30 minutes.

  • Burj Khalifa: Cost Estimate - AED 149 (observation deck ticket),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Dubai Mall: Cost Estimate - Dependent on activities, Time Spent - 4-5 hours

Sunday, October 22: Desert Safari

Experience the beauty and adventure of the Dubai desert with a thrilling desert safari. Start your morning by embarking on an exhilarating dune bashing experience in a 4x4 vehicle. Enjoy the adrenaline rush as your skilled driver maneuvers through the golden sands. Afterward, visit a traditional Bedouin camp where you can ride camels, try sandboarding, and get henna tattoos. Indulge in a delicious BBQ dinner while enjoying mesmerizing belly dance and fire shows under the starry desert sky.

  • Desert Safari: Cost Estimate - AED 200-300, Time Spent - 6-7 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path experiences, consider exploring Alserkal Avenue, an industrial district transformed into a hub for contemporary art galleries, cafes, and creative spaces. Take a stroll through the Bastakiya Art Fair, held in Al Fahidi every weekend, showcasing local and regional artists. To get a taste of local flavors, visit Ravi Restaurant in Satwa, known for its delicious Pakistani and Indian cuisine favored by both locals and expats.
